Ben DeVore's Review of Firefield Tactical 8-32x50AO IR Rifle Scope
I mounted this on my Ruger precision rimfire. The scope seems rather delicate and I don't think I'd mount it on anything bigger than a .223. At 200 yards, full zoom I could see flies walking on my target. You can see .22 bullet holes at same distance. Adjustment absolutely sucks. The hold offs are in mils the adjustments in MOA, is a SFP scope, but no information on what power the mils read accurately. The knobs don't repeat. First time I used it 44 clicks got me zeroed at 200...2nd time it was 54 clicks..3rd time it was 63... if you don't plan to range with it, or shoot different distances, it's a decent scope for the price. However, it's useless on a Ruger precision rimfire because my rifle has a built in 30moa rail and at 100 yards I'm shooting 4 inches high with my elevation fully depressed.
